Sourdough Trapping Vote Comment There is no such thing as a humane trap or a painless trap. Trapping
o en breaks animalsʼ legs and animals o en sever their legs and feet trying to escape. They dislocate their
shoulders, and su er lacerations, torn muscles, and cuts to their mouths and gums. Many animals are killed
by another animal before the trapper finds them. Animals drown in submerged or partially submerged traps
and snares. Trapping also causes significant terror resulting in shock. Some animals are le so long they die
of starvation or exposure. No wonder trapping has been banned in several states. Trappers may claim they
feed their families by trapping and that it provides a viable source of income, but income from trapping has
been non-existent for decades because there is little to no demand for pelts. Trapping is expensive and
requires investment in vehicles, gasoline, time and equipment. When surveyed, the majority of trappers say
